About the Role We are looking for an experienced General Superintendent to manage the day-to-day operations of multifamily construction projects in the Boise, Idaho area. The General Superintendent will be responsible for overseeing multiple construction projects while leading a team of Field Superintendents. This role ensures that all field operations are executed safely, efficiently, and to the highest quality standards, while keeping projects on schedule and within budget. The General Superintendent serves as a strategic leader, driving productivity, fostering team development, and building strong relationships with subcontractors, suppliers, and project stakeholders. Key Responsibilities: Oversee field operations across multiple projects, ensuring labor, materials, and equipment are effectively coordinated for efficient execution. Provide leadership and direction to Field Superintendents, subcontractors, and on-site personnel to maintain productive and high-performing teams. Mentor and develop Field Superintendents by fostering continuous learning, improving technical and leadership capabilities, and supporting long-term career growth. Responsible for hiring, training, assigning work, evaluating performance and making recommendations regarding advancement, discipline, or separation for on-site team members. Ensure strong communication and collaboration between field staff, project management, subcontractors, and key stakeholders. Develop, monitor, and maintain master schedules and project look-aheads to ensure milestones and deadlines are met. Enforce and promote all safety protocols, ensuring full compliance with OSHA and regulatory standards. Conduct regular site visits, safety meetings, inspections, and audits to maintain a safe and compliant work environment. Ensure all work meets quality standards, design intent, and applicable building codes through consistent on-site inspections and timely resolution of issues. Oversee procurement planning and material logistics, ensuring timely delivery, proper storage, and availability of required resources. Expand and maintain a robust subcontractor and supplier network to support project needs, improve collaboration, and ensure competitive pricing and quality. Identify and implement creative solutions to improve construction efficiency, boost productivity, and reduce project costs without compromising quality. Serve as the primary liaison for field operations, providing timely project updates, communicating issues, and ensuring alignment across teams. Identify and resolve field challenges, delays, and conflicts by facilitating effective problem-solving with project teams. Ensure projects are accurately and timely documenting all work in the field, inspections, and safety issues in accordance with company and legal standards. Perform other related duties as assigned, in compliance with applicable laws and consistent with the essential functions of the role.
